Better Services to Farmers

DPI is changing how it designs and delivers services, so farmers receive better targeted more accessible and more relevant services that help them make better decisions about their businesses.

To improve services, DPI will collaborate with more services providers, industry and community groups who are well placed to meet the changing needs of farmers.
